目的:探讨围手术期输血对肝恶性肿瘤术后远期复发率及近期并发症的影响。方法:回顾性分析90例肝恶性肿瘤手术患者,按照有无输血分为2组,每组45例,对其临床资料进行分析。结果:1随访90例肝恶性肿瘤手术患者显示35例患者复发,其中输血组有25例(71.4%)患者复发,无输血组有10例(28.6%)复发,输血组患者术后复发显著高于无输血组(P<0.05),多元回归分析显示,TNM分期、淋巴结转移、围手术期输血均为影响患者预后的独立危险因素。2输血组患者肿瘤大小、侵袭度、淋巴结转移、TNM分期与无输血组比较,差异有统计学意义(P<0.05)。结论:肝恶性肿瘤患者术后复发率及相关并发症的发生与围术期输血存在着密切的关系,围手术期输血可作为判断肝恶性肿瘤远期复发的危险因素。
Objective: To investigate the effect of perioperative blood transfusion on postoperative long-term recurrence and recent complications of liver malignant tumor. Methods: Ninety patients with liver cancer were retrospectively analyzed. The clinical data were analyzed according to the presence or absence of blood transfusion in two groups, 45 cases in each group. A total of 90 patients with liver cancer were followed up for recurrence in 35 patients. Among them, 25 patients (71.4%) in the transfusion group relapsed, and 10 patients (28.6%) in the transfusion group relapsed. The recurrence rate was significantly higher in the transfusion group Multivariate regression analysis showed that TNM staging, lymph node metastasis and perioperative blood transfusion were both independent risk factors influencing prognosis in patients without blood transfusions (P <0.05). There were significant differences in tumor size, invasiveness, lymph node metastasis and TNM stage between the two groups (P <0.05). Conclusion: The incidence of postoperative recurrence and related complications in patients with liver cancer is closely related to perioperative blood transfusion. Perioperative blood transfusion can be used as a risk factor for long-term recurrence of hepatic malignancies.
